So how do you eat a kiwifruit? They get soft and mushy when its nice and ripe, so what you can do is to slice it down the middle, and scoop out the flesh with a little spoon. I prefer to peel the skin off by running a knife around the sides, it’s easy and neat and doesn’t mush up the flesh, and you can get these nice slices with the beautiful pattern inside.
